34154867182458050 is an even composite number. It is composed of six dist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of four hundred eighty-six divisors.

Prime factorization of 34154867182458050:

2 × 52 × 72 × 312 × 432 × 28012

(2 × 5 × 5 × 7 × 7 × 31 × 31 × 43 × 43 × 2801 × 2801)
